个人博客自动化:OpenClaw+Qwen3-32B从草稿到发布的完整流程

1. 为什么需要自动化写作工作流

作为一个技术博主,我经常面临这样的困境:灵感来临时能快速产出内容,但后续的排版、配图、发布等琐碎流程却消耗了大量时间。直到发现OpenClaw+Qwen3-32B的组合,才真正实现了从灵感到发布的端到端自动化。

这套方案的核心价值在于:

  • 创作专注:将精力集中在内容本身,机械性工作交给AI
  • 流程标准化:确保每篇文章都经过语法检查、格式统一等环节
  • 24/7可用:即使深夜有灵感,也能立即启动写作流程

最让我惊喜的是,整个过程不需要编写复杂脚本,通过自然语言指令就能调整各个环节。下面分享我的完整实践过程。

2. 环境准备与基础配置

2.1 OpenClaw的安装与初始化

在MacBook Pro上安装OpenClaw只需一条命令:

curl -fsSL https://openclaw.ai/install.sh | bash

安装完成后,运行配置向导选择Qwen3-32B作为默认模型:

openclaw onboard

在向导中选择:

  • Mode: Advanced(为了自定义模型)
  • Provider: Qwen
  • Default model: qwen3-32b
  • Skills: 全选写作相关技能

2.2 博客项目目录绑定

为了让OpenClaw能操作我的Hugo博客项目,需要配置工作区路径。编辑~/.openclaw/openclaw.json

{
  "workspace": {
    "blog": "/Users/me/Documents/my-blog"
  }
}

这个配置让后续所有文件操作都在博客项目目录下进行,避免误改其他文件。

3. 从零生成一篇技术博客

3.1 通过自然语言启动写作

在OpenClaw的Web控制台输入:

写一篇关于OpenClaw自动化写作的技术博客,要求:
- 字数1500左右
- 包含3个实际案例
- 使用Markdown格式
- 适合中级开发者阅读

Qwen3-32B会先返回一个提纲确认:

## 提纲确认
1. 自动化写作的价值(300字)
2. OpenClaw核心功能解析(400字)
3. 三个典型场景演示(各300字)
4. 注意事项与优化建议(200字)

回复"确认"后,AI开始逐部分生成内容,整个过程约3分钟。生成的文件会自动保存在/content/posts/openclaw-writing.md

3.2 自动增强内容质量

安装写作增强技能包:

clawhub install writing-enhancer

这个技能包提供以下自动化处理:

  1. 语法检查:修正技术术语的大小写错误
  2. 代码块格式化:统一代码缩进和语言标注
  3. 术语一致性:确保全文统一使用"OpenClaw"而非其他变体
  4. 链接验证:检查所有外部链接的可达性

对生成的文章执行增强:

对/content/posts/openclaw-writing.md执行写作增强

4. 自动化排版与发布

4.1 智能排版调整

通过自然语言指令调整排版风格:

将文章排版改为:
- 标题使用##层级
- 代码块增加行号
- 每段不超过5行
- 图片居中对齐

OpenClaw会调用预装的markdown-formatter技能执行这些变更,整个过程无需手动编辑Markdown。

4.2 配图生成与插入

虽然Qwen3-32B不能直接生成图片,但可以自动插入合适的图床链接:

为文章插入3张示意图,使用主题:
1. OpenClaw架构流程图
2. 写作工作流时序图
3. 效果对比图

AI会:

  1. 在Unsplash/阿里云OSS等配置的图床搜索合适图片
  2. 生成描述性alt文本
  3. 在文档适当位置插入![描述](URL)标记

4.3 一键发布到Hugo

配置发布凭据后,最简单的发布指令是:

将当前文章发布到Hugo博客

背后执行的完整流程包括:

  1. 运行hugo --cleanDestinationDir
  2. 将生成的静态文件同步到GitHub Pages
  3. 触发CDN缓存刷新
  4. 返回发布后的URL

5. 实践中的经验与优化

经过两个月的实际使用,我总结了几个关键优化点:

模型参数调优
openclaw.json中调整Qwen3-32B的生成参数:

{
  "models": {
    "generationConfig": {
      "temperature": 0.7,
      "maxTokens": 1500,
      "topP": 0.9
    }
  }
}

这些设置让技术文章既保持创造性又不会天马行空。

自定义技能开发
为博客特有的Front Matter格式开发了校验技能:

// 检查Front Matter字段完整性
function validateFrontmatter(content) {
  const required = ['title', 'date', 'tags']
  // ...校验逻辑
}

执行监控
通过openclaw activity命令查看任务历史,发现图片插入步骤耗时最长,于是调整为异步执行。

6. 安全注意事项

自动化写作虽然方便,但需要注意:

  1. 内容审核:AI生成的内容必须人工复核,特别是技术准确性
  2. 权限控制:OpenClaw不应有博客仓库的强制推送权限
  3. 版本备份:重要修改前自动创建git commit
  4. 敏感信息:确保API密钥等不会误写入文章

我的做法是在关键节点设置人工确认:

{
  "skills": {
    "blog-publisher": {
      "confirmBeforePush": true
    }
  }
}

获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

Logo

小龙虾开发者社区是 CSDN 旗下专注 OpenClaw 生态的官方阵地,聚焦技能开发、插件实践与部署教程,为开发者提供可直接落地的方案、工具与交流平台,助力高效构建与落地 AI 应用

更多推荐